Separation of close boiling point mixtures of alkylphenols, such as p-cresol/2,6-xylenol, m-cresol/2,6-xylenol and p-cresol/m-cresol has been attempted using commercially available ion-exchange resins. The basic resins selectively adsorb the cresol isomers from their mixtures with 2,6-xylenol. The separation seems to be decided by the thermodynamic selectivity in the ion-exchange resin framework with diffusional selectivity also contributing to the separation.
